Charley Pride, a wonderful Country Music artist and singer has passed away at age 86, supposedly from covid-19 related illness. He was a member of the Country Music Hall Of Fame, The Grand Ole Opry, and had just received the Willie Nelson Lifetime Achievement Award last month.

Some of Charley's best known songs include "Kiss An Angel Good Morning", "Kaw-Liga", "Just Between You And Me", "All I Have To Offer You Is Me", and "Is Anybody Goin' To San Antone".

He was a remarkable singer and a true Gentleman. He will be missed.
